Anastigmat is a term used in optics, particularly in the field of lenses, to refer to a lens or optical system designed to correct for astigmatism. Astigmatism is an optical defect that occurs when a lens fails to focus light evenly, resulting in distorted or blurred vision. An anastigmat lens has special optical elements that compensate for this irregularity, allowing for clearer and sharper images.

Anastigmatic refers to an optical system, such as a lens or microscope, that is free from astigmatism, meaning it can form images without distortion or blurring caused by unequal focus in different meridians. It is capable of producing sharp and clear images across the entire field of view.

Anastomose is a verb that means to unite or connect two separate things, especially blood vessels or pipes, to allow the flow of fluid or blood to resume; to form a connection or passageway between two separated parts.

Anastomoses (noun) refers to the surgical connection or union of two or more tubular structures, such as blood vessels, ducts, or vessels in the body. For example, a blood vessel anastomosis is a surgical procedure that connects two blood vessels to restore blood flow to a specific area of the body.
